Remembering Ann Blyth: A Hollywood Icon's Legacy

Ann Blyth, a talented actress and singer known for her role as Veda in the classic film Mildred Pierce, has passed away at the age of 98. She had a successful career in Hollywood, starring in several musicals and dramas. Blyth's performance in Mildred Pierce earned her an Oscar nomination for best supporting actress. She also appeared in other notable films such as Brute Force and Mr. Peabody and the Mermaid.
Blyth's career began at a young age when she signed with Universal Studios and appeared in several musicals. Her breakthrough role came when she was cast as Veda in Mildred Pierce opposite Joan Crawford. The film was a critical and commercial success, and Blyth's performance was praised for her portrayal of the complex character. Despite facing a setback due to a sledding accident shortly after filming, Blyth continued to work in Hollywood and appeared in various films and TV shows.
In addition to her film career, Blyth was also known for her work in commercials, particularly for Hostess Cupcakes. She had a successful personal life as well, marrying James McNulty, with whom she had five children.
